BUDAPEST, Nov 30 – Dec 2, 2010

The Danube Tourist Commission in co-operation with the Hungarian National Tourist Office hosted the fourteenth annual Danube Shipping Conference and the fourth Danube Biking and Hiking Conference in Budapest, from November 30 until December 3. More than 200 international Danube tourism experts came to the event and spent the remains of the successful season.
During the event took place presentations about up to date topics such as the EU Danube Strategy, recycling, the water quality of the Danube, the EU Passenger rights on river cruises, Schengen and custom controls, as well as many ashore topics such as the presentations of the Liszt year 2011 in Hungary, the Danube city Bratislava and new developments regarding the beautiful Wachau region in Austria. Particularly interesting were presentations about the additional offers for river cruise travellers, for example guided city tours by bike in Budapest or the combination of river cruises and wellness or the further development of the Danube cycling route (Euro Velo 6) and the strong focus of Danube hiking trails in Germany, Austria and Romania. All those presentations provided useful information and inputs for developers of cruise ship journeys for creating future programs.
